Best time to visit Sofia, Bulgaria
Month-by-month breakdown of weather, crowds, prices, and seasonal highlights.
| Month | Score | Weather | Crowds | Prices | Highlights |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| January | -2-4°C, cloudy with occasional snow | low | low |
⚠ Very cold, limited daylight hours. | |
| February | 0-6°C, variable, chance of snow | low | low |
⚠ Still cold, but thawing can occur. | |
| March | 4-12°C, often rainy, some sunshine | low | low |
⚠ Weather can be unpredictable, muddy. | |
| April | 8-18°C, mixed sun and showers | moderate | moderate |
⚠ Easter holidays can bring a slight crowd increase. | |
| May | 12-22°C, mostly sunny with scattered showers | moderate | moderate |
⚠ The city is vibrant with spring colors. | |
| June | 16-26°C, warm and sunny, occasional thunderstorms | high | high |
⚠ Peak season begins, book accommodations in advance. | |
| July | 19-30°C, hot and sunny | peak | peak |
⚠ Can be very hot; consider Vitosha for cooler air. | |
| August | 20-32°C, hot and dry | peak | peak |
⚠ August is often the hottest month, with potential for heatwaves. | |
| September | 14-24°C, pleasant sunshine, cooler evenings | moderate | moderate |
⚠ Shoulder season offers a great balance of weather and fewer crowds than summer. | |
| October | 9-18°C, crisp air, mix of sun and rain | low | moderate |
⚠ Days get shorter, rain becomes more frequent. | |
| November | 4-12°C, cool, often overcast and damp | low | low |
⚠ Winter is setting in, outdoor activities are limited. | |
| December | -1-5°C, cold, often snowy and icy | moderate | high |
⚠ Very cold; prices surge for holidays despite limited daylight. |

Insider timing tips
- •The shoulder seasons (April-May and September-October) offer the best balance of pleasant weather, manageable crowds, and reasonable prices.
- •While July and August are hot, they are ideal for exploring higher-altitude areas like Vitosha National Park for cooler temperatures.
- •Many smaller shops and some restaurants may close or reduce hours during the peak summer vacation months (July-August) as locals leave the city.
- •Eastern Orthodox Christmas and New Year's celebrations mean prices can be high in late December and early January, despite the very cold weather.
- •Vitosha Mountain is a year-round attraction, but accessibility and conditions vary dramatically between the snow-covered winter and the hiking-friendly spring and summer.
